New strategy on child protection in France

New strategy on child protection in France released in October 2019 has triggered several reactions from civil society organisations.

Eurochild’s member National Federation of Association for Child Protection – CNAPE welcomes the new national strategy on child protection in particular the measures on prevention and protection of children and families that are in line with the positions defended by the federation. CNAPE has been advocating in long-term for the development of measures to protect a child (from 0-18) and for range of services to adequately respond to the needs of child and family. 

Read more details in CNAPE’s press release (download in French).

UNICEF France has also released its reaction. According to them the strategy introduces the useful measures but more needs to be done.
